mobvoi-home-treadmill-pro-foldable-treadmill-for-home-compatible-with-smartwatches-virtual-training-trails-running-and-walking-workout-modes-bluetooth-speaker-remote-control-fitness-exercise-10.jpgWalking is a low impact exercise that helps reduce stiffness in joints. It can also help increase levels of energy and increase mental alertness. But, many people have difficulty fitting regular physical activity into their daily schedules.

Another option is an under-desk treadmill that allows you to walk while working. These treadmills are lightweight and small and can be kept in a hidden location when not in use.

Easy to store

Many under-desk machines can be folded into two, making it easy to store them out of view. This is especially convenient for those who reside in a small space or have a home with children or pets. They have a short cord, and you'll need to keep them close to an electrical outlet. The top treadmills for under-desk use are also lightweight making them easy to move from room to room, or even across country.

If you're trying to shed weight or simply move around during the day, a walk machine under desk is an excellent way to improve your health and well-being. Studies have shown that regular exercise can lessen the negative effects caused by long periods of inactivity like stress, back pain and high blood pressure. It also helps enhance cognitive function and decrease the risk of developing diseases.

The treadmills under desks we've reviewed are simple to set up and use, and can be folded up for storage when not in use. The WalkingPad P1 can be easily hidden in a cabinet, or under the couch. Its clever folding treadmill desk design allows it to fit in tight spaces, such as desks with alcoves.

Most under-desk treadmills also feature a safety rail to guarantee your safety while using them. They also come with transportation wheels for easy portability. Some models have a built in power saving mode that automatically goes into sleep after 10 minutes.

The under-desk treadmills that we examined aren't just easy to operate and assemble and assemble, but also simple to maintain. They're designed to last and mobile, meaning they will not require frequent repairs or replacement parts. They're also affordable making them an excellent option for those looking to be healthy when working.

Under-desk treadmills can be utilized at any speed that is comfortable for the user. However, they aren't recommended for use at high speeds, as they can cause injury to joints and muscles. For those who run at very high speeds, it's recommended to purchase a conventional treadmill.

Easy to maintain

A treadmill that is under the desk is a great method to boost your fitness while at work. Walking while working can help you lose weight, improve your blood sugar and insulin levels, and help strengthen your immune system. It's a low-impact workout that you can easily integrate into your daily routine. The most appealing aspect is that it takes only a few minutes to enjoy the benefits of this exercise. Like any exercise machine it is important to maintain and repair your under desk treadmill regularly. To ensure the machine is working properly, make sure you inspect the belt for wear and tear, clean it regularly, and ensure that the deck is well-lubricated to avoid damage.

To get the most out of your treadmill under the desk, choose one that is designed for walking only and has a quiet motor. This will minimize distractions, allowing you to use the treadmill during phone calls or meetings without disturbing anyone else. Find a device that has a speed range that is matched to the pace you prefer to walk at and a remote that allows you to change speeds quickly.

Under-desk treadmills are often compact and can be placed under your desk or in the corner of your home. Some models are built into desks to allow you to walk while working. These models can be more expensive, but they are worth it if you want an environment that is healthier.

When choosing an under-desk treadmill for under desk, you should look for a model that is easy to set up and has a display screen that shows your speed as well as distance and calories burned. Certain models come with an automatic stop feature and an integrated timer which makes them perfect for professionals who are constantly on the move.

The UREVO 2-in-1 Under-Desk Treadmill is another excellent option. It features a dual folding design and can be tucked under a desk or inside an armoire when not in use. It also has a powerful 2.5HP motor that is quiet and can support up to 265 pounds. Its light weight and durable steel frame make it simple to lift for storage or transport.
